| 成果简介 | NOVELTY - Invention relates to a method for manufacturing a non-polarizable electrode of an electrochemical capacitor with a double electric layer with an alkaline electrolyte, and can be used for development and manufacture of electrochemical capacitors for vehicles. Increase in capacity and cycling of electrolytic capacitor with non-polarizable electrode is technical result, which is achieved due to the fact that the porous base of the electrode in the form of a composite electrochemical coating from lithium hydroxide on the surface of a steel strip is formed during cathodic electrochemical deposition of a coating from a nickel-containing electrolyte containing, g/l: sulphamic nickel 100–120, boric acid 30–40, carbonyl nickel powder 3–5, at pH 4.5–5, pulse current at current density 100–120 mA/cm2, pulse and pause time 0.5 s for 15–20 minutes, with subsequent cathode electrochemical treatment of the tape with pulse current at current density of 150–200 mA/cm2, pulse and pause time of 0.1 s for 30 minutes. USE - Electrical engineering. ADVANTAGE - Increased thickness of nickel hydroxide layer increases resource stability of electrochemical capacitor. 1 cl, 2 dwg, 1 tbl, 3 ex |
